BACKGROUND: we use Solaris boxes as desktops, and Linux boxes remotely.
Both Solaris and Linux boxes have Chinese language support. Recently we
tried to install Wine (ver. 20040121) on a remote Linux box. Wine's
NOTEPAD.EXE works perfectly, with Chinese fonts in menus. However,
we face a problem with MS-Office 2000:

PROBLEM: SETUP.EXE starts and displays a short note in Chinese (the same
font as in NODEPAD.EXE, so it looks like it is not just showing a bitmap),
however on subsequent screens the font is broken (i.e. all characters show
up as small empty squares).

Has anybody have more luck with similar install? Any debugging tips?

I have read that Crossover supports Chinese MS-Office 2000, so I guess
there should be a way to force Wine to do it too.
